The fifth Active Norfolk Corporate Games took place on June 14. After closely fought matches in 10 sports, a team from Norfolk county Council were crowned champions of the 2013 event. 38 teams from local businesses competed in ten sports ranging from hockey to golf, curling and gymnastics. » 17.06.2013   |  Grants of up to £30k available to community groups Community projects are today being offered a dream ticket to a major funding boost, thanks to a new Eastern Daily Press campaign. The EDP is joining forces with the Big Lottery Fund to award £250,000 of Lottery good-cause cash to community projects in the EDP’s circulation area of Norfolk, North Suffolk and East Cambridgeshire.
